About Me
As a child, adolescent, and addiction psychiatrist at the Child Study Center, part of Hassenfeld Children’s Hospital at NYU Langone, I am dedicated to providing comprehensive and compassionate care to my patients and families. I chose a career in child psychiatry because of my desire to make a meaningful difference in the lives of young people. To this end, my approach to care is holistic in nature. I recognize that medication management or therapy alone is often insufficient to bring about lasting change. To truly make a difference, it’s important to address all of the social and structural factors that influence our mental health and wellness.
With fellowship training in child, adolescent, and addiction psychiatry, I bring a unique and valuable perspective to my clinical practice. My expertise lies in the treatment of adolescents and young adults struggling with substance use or addiction. Throughout my career, I have also been involved in health equity research, particularly in understanding and addressing racial disparities in opioid use disorder treatment.
My background in public health has driven me to develop innovative care models and increase access to care. Since joining NYU Langone, I have had the immense pleasure of working with others to expand our addiction treatment services within the Child Study Center, which is a real gap in our field and area of immense need.
